Sidewalk cleaning services typically encompass the removal of dirt, debris, stains, and buildup from concrete or paved walkways. This work can include power washing, sweeping, and spot cleaning to improve curb appeal and maintain safety standards. Depending on the property, contractors may also address issues like moss, algae, or graffiti that can accumulate over time. Clarifying the scope of work beforehand ensures that all necessary tasks are covered, whether it involves routine maintenance or more intensive cleaning to restore the sidewalk’s appearance.
Defining the scope of sidewalk cleaning is essential for establishing clear expectations and avoiding misunderstandings. Property owners should consider specifying which areas need attention, whether the focus is on entire walkways or specific sections. It’s also helpful to outline any particular concerns, such as stubborn stains or surface damage, so that contractors can tailor their approach. Having a detailed scope in writing helps ensure that both parties agree on the work to be performed and provides a reference point should questions or issues arise later.

When comparing contractors for sidewalk cleaning, it is important to evaluate their experience with similar projects. Service providers who have a history of working on sidewalks in environments comparable to your property are more likely to understand the specific challenges involved. Asking about their past projects can provide insight into their familiarity with different types of surfaces, urban settings, or unique site conditions. This background helps ensure that the contractor has the practical knowledge needed to deliver quality results tailored to your sidewalk’s particular needs.
A clear and detailed written scope of work is essential for setting expectations and avoiding misunderstandings. When reviewing proposals or discussing options, look for a comprehensive description of the tasks included, such as debris removal, surface washing, or stain treatment. The scope should also specify any areas or features that are excluded, so there is transparency about what the service will cover. Having a well-defined scope in writing helps both parties understand the extent of the work and provides a reference point for any future discussions or adjustments.
